Jakarta, Java vs Beni Suef Climate & Distance Between

Egypt flag
  • The distance between Jakarta, Java, Indonesia and Beni Suef, Egypt is approximately 8,972 km or 5,576 mi.
  • To reach Jakarta, Java in this distance one would set out from Beni Suef bearing 102.5° or ESE and follow the great circles arc to approach Jakarta, Java bearing 120.9° or ESE .
  • Jakarta, Java has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am) whereas Beni Suef has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
  • Jakarta, Java is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Beni Suef is in or near the subtropical desert biome.
  • The average annual temperature is 6 °C (10.7°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 15.5 °C (27.9°F) less in Jakarta, Java. The continentality subtype is extremely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1749 mm (68.9 in) more which is equivalent to 1749 l/m² (42.92 US gal/ft²) or 17,490,000 l/ha (1,869,797 US gal/ac) more. About 292 1/2 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 13° higher in Jakarta, Java than in Beni Suef.
  • Relative humidity levels are 30.5%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 13.4°C (24.1°F) higher.
